关于txt导入Excel

当你想将txt文件导入到Excel中时,你可以使用Excel的数据导入功能来实现。你可以按照以下步骤进行操作:

  1. 打开Excel,并选择要导入数据的工作表。
  2. 在Excel菜单栏中选择“数据”选项卡,然后点击“从文本”选项。
  3. 在弹出的对话框中,选择要导入的txt文件,并点击“导入”按钮。
  4. 在导入向导中选择文件的分隔符(如逗号、制表符等),然后点击“下一步”。
  5. 在下一个步骤中,可以选择数据的格式和布局,然后点击“完成”。
  6. Excel会将txt文件中的数据导入到当前选定的工作表中。

如果你想通过代码来实现txt文件导入到Excel中,你可以使用VBA(Visual Basic for Applications)编写以下代码:

Sub ImportTxtFile()
    Dim ws As Worksheet
    Dim fileName As String

    '选择要导入的txt文件
    fileName = Application.GetOpenFilename("Text Files (*.txt), *.txt")

    '如果文件名不为空,则导入数据
    If fileName <> "False" Then
        Set ws = ThisWorkbook.Sheets.Add
        With ws.QueryTables.Add(Connection:="TEXT;" & fileName, Destination:=ws.Range("A1"))
            .TextFileConsecutiveDelimiter = False
            .TextFileTabDelimiter = False
            .TextFileSemicolonDelimiter = False
            .TextFileCommaDelimiter = True
            .TextFilePlatform = xlWindows
            .Refresh
        End With
    End If
End Sub

这段VBA代码会打开一个文件选择对话框,让用户选择要导入的txt文件,然后将文件中的数据导入到新建的工作表中。你可以将这段代码复制粘贴到Excel的VBA编辑器中,然后执行它来实现txt文件导入到Excel中。

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值